Selfridge Joins Zions Bancorporation as EVP and Head of Wealth Management

Zions Bancorporation appointed Mike Selfridge as executive vice president and head of wealth management, effective June 1, 2026.

Most recently, Selfridge served as head of client and family office solutions and client credit advisory at Bessemer Trust, where he was responsible for lending, private credit and banking solutions for ultra-high-net-worth clients and family-owned businesses. He led the strategy, business development and delivery of family office services for the firm’s largest relationships, driving growth and excellence in service delivery.

Prior to Bessemer Trust, Selfridge was senior executive vice president and chief banking officer at First Republic Bank, where he oversaw the delivery of private banking services to approximately 300,000 households and wealth management solutions to ultra-high-net-worth clients, in addition to overseeing consumer lending and business banking.

“We are thrilled to have Mike Selfridge join our team,” Harris H. Simmons, chairman and CEO of Zions Bancorporation, said. “He brings a singular depth of experience and talent in addressing the needs of affluent clients and in building exceptional teams of bankers and wealth advisors working together to serve them. We look forward to the extraordinary contributions we know he will make to our success.”

Selfridge said, “I am honored to join Zions Bancorporation and help build upon its strong legacy of client service, community commitment and growth across the West. I look forward to expanding its wealth management platform and delivering exceptional outcomes for clients and stakeholders alike.”
